  • [ Location ] Loei

    According to legend, when Prince Vessandorn, the Buddha's penultimate incarnation, returned to his city, the welcoming procession was so delightful that spirits emerged to celebrate.

    Phi Ta Khon is celebrated largely by young men who dress as spirits to parade a sacred Buddha image and tease villagers.

    Buddhist monks recite the story of the Buddha's last incarnation before attaining Enlightenment.
